Crunchyroll
Best Anime Streaming Service Overall
Crunchyroll offers three subscription tiers, all of which provide ad-free access to their full anime library. New users can enjoy a 14-day free trial, after which the cheapest plan is available for $7.99 per month. Even without a subscription, you can watch some anime for free with ads, including titles like Chainsaw Man and My Hero Academia.

What are the best sites to watch anime for free?
In addition to Tubi and the limited free selection on Crunchyroll, other platforms offer free anime streaming. RetroCrush specializes in "vintage" anime and cartoons, featuring classics like Astro Boy, Yu-Gi-Oh!, and City Hunter. Sling TV's FreeStream also includes several anime channels with on-demand series such as Fruits Basket, Maid-Sama, and Ghost Stories.

Thanks to Crunchyroll's licensing agreements, new episodes are typically available within a day of their original airtime, which is why it's considered the best overall streaming service for anime. Even anime that eventually appears on Netflix or Hulu often premieres on Crunchyroll first.
If you're eager to watch a new episode or special live, you might need to use a VPN to access local Japanese channels like FujiTV.
